So I've downloaded the Quest Helper add on and followed the guide exactly but I still can't get it to work. No matter what I do the AddOn icon won't appear on the character selection screen.

I've recently repaired all files for WoW using the WoW repair tool and since it has just stopped working.

How did you install it? On my Vista workstation I have it installed under c:\Users\Public\Games\World of Warcraft\Interface\AddOns. In there you should have a folder named QuestHelper that has around 110 objects in it (6 folders and the rest are files).

If you have something like Questhelper-3.2.177 then a questhelper folder in your addons folder, you will need to move the one named questhelper so it is directly in the addons folder.
